MORTAL KOMBAT 2 (2024)

🎬 Mortal Kombat 2 (2024)
Rating: ★★★★☆

Plot: Mortal Kombat 2 (2024) picks up after the events of the first film, as the Earthrealm warriors regroup and prepare for the next Mortal Kombat tournament. With the stakes higher than ever, the combatants face a new set of formidable opponents from Outworld, led by the menacing Emperor Shao Kahn. As the characters’ individual stories and powers evolve, they must form alliances and confront the dark forces threatening their world. Sub-Zero, Liu Kang, Sonya Blade, and Johnny Cage, along with some newcomers from the game universe, all play pivotal roles in the next battle to save Earthrealm. As the line between allies and enemies blurs, the players in this tournament must survive brutal fights, uncover dark secrets, and battle for the fate of their world.

Review:
Mortal Kombat 2 (2024) successfully builds on the foundation laid by its predecessor, delivering even more brutal action, impressive special effects, and an engaging storyline that stays true to the spirit of the iconic video game franchise. The film’s pacing is relentless, with heart-pounding fight sequences that are choreographed in a way that captures the chaos and intensity of the original Mortal Kombat games. The tournament-style fights, known for their over-the-top violence and dramatic finishers, are showcased beautifully, making fans of the games feel right at home in this blood-soaked continuation.

The character development in Mortal Kombat 2 is another highlight. While the first film set the stage, the sequel gives us a deeper look into the backgrounds and motivations of characters like Liu Kang, Sonya, and the enigmatic Sub-Zero, who remains a fan favorite. New characters are introduced, adding both excitement and fresh dynamics to the film, as their unique abilities and backstories blend seamlessly with the established lore of the Mortal Kombat universe.

The visual effects are top-notch, especially when it comes to the CGI powers and fatalities. The film doesn’t shy away from its iconic brutal finishers, delivering spectacular, bloody, and jaw-dropping moments that make fans cheer. The way the film embraces the over-the-top violence without losing its connection to the emotional stakes of the characters adds a layer of excitement that fans have been eagerly awaiting.

While the plot may not break new ground, it captures the essence of the Mortal Kombat franchise – fierce competition, high stakes, and the battle between good and evil. The movie also wisely builds the tension around the upcoming tournament, leaving plenty of room for future films in the series. Some of the storytelling feels a bit formulaic, but it doesn’t detract from the overall enjoyment of the movie. The dialogue is often playful, with just enough humor to balance the intense moments of combat.

The film does an excellent job of balancing nostalgia for long-time fans of the franchise while also offering a fresh perspective for newcomers. The visuals and fight sequences elevate the experience, ensuring that Mortal Kombat 2 doesn’t just feel like a video game adaptation, but an epic battle for survival.
